A:AnswerYou can cut the included wires and attach however much wire you need (wire nuts or solder). My room is prewired, so I did exactly that to use the installed wires and my receiver sits behind my subwoofer.
A:AnswerI have my cable box and a game system connected to the 2 HDMI inputs on this surround system. The HDMI out goes to the TV and everything works perfectly. The TV still has audio, but I turn it all the way down to enjoy the surround sound. If you chose to have the TV then powering another sound system (bar) then there is no reason that it wouldn't work. A:AnswerHi Elias, no. There are no buttons or knobs on the subwoofer. However, there are buttons on the remote wherein you can select different sound fields/modes which utilize the bass or intensity of the subwoofer. Thanks, -Mark
